Session Overview
The rapid expansion of AI and cloud computing is driving unprecedented demand for digital infrastructure. The challenge is no longer whether data centres will be built, but how they can be designed to create positive outcomes for people, communities and ecosystems.
This roundtable will bring together leaders from technology, infrastructure, finance, philanthropy and government to explore:
- Regenerative design and biomimicry
- Community-centred development
- Responsible supply chains and materials
- Opportunities for wider societal benefit through digital infrastructure
Outcome: Develop the foundations of an Inclusive and Regenerative Data Centre Framework, identify pilot opportunities and establish priorities for cross-sector collaboration.
